What irrigation system works best in Jeddah's climate?
Drip irrigation systems are widely recommended for Jeddah properties because they deliver water directly to root zones with minimal evaporation loss. Automated controllers that adjust watering schedules based on seasonal temperature changes provide the best results for both residential gardens and commercial landscapes in the Makkah Region.

When is the best time to start a landscaping project in Jeddah?
The cooler months from October through March offer the best conditions for planting, soil preparation, and major landscape installations in Jeddah. Summer heat stresses new plantings and makes outdoor labor difficult, so most professionals recommend scheduling substantial work during the winter season.

What plants thrive in Jeddah gardens with minimal water?
Drought-tolerant species including date palms, bougainvillea, oleander, and various succulents perform well in Jeddah's climate with limited irrigation. Native and adapted plants reduce water consumption and maintenance effort significantly compared to temperate species.

How do I choose between electric and gas-powered garden equipment?
Electric and battery-powered tools suit smaller residential gardens and offer quieter operation with lower emissions. Gas-powered equipment from brands like Toro handles larger properties and heavier workloads but requires more maintenance and fuel costs. Match the power source to your property size and usage frequency.
